First-Hand Experience: What to Expect During CNA Training

Starting CNA classes in MA involves both classroom learning and practical clinical hours. expect to cover topics such​ as patient care techniques, nutrition, infection control, and communication skills. Hands-on training might involve bedside care, vitals monitoring, and ⁤working with diverse patient populations.

Most programs include assessments, written exams,⁢ and a skills demonstration. Success depends on ‍active participation, studying, and embracing the learning ​process.

After completing your coursework, you’ll be eligible ‍to take the certification ‌exam, which is essential for employment as a CNA in Massachusetts.

Understanding CNA License⁢ reciprocity in Florida

Florida recognizes CNA licenses from other states through ​a process called reciprocity or endorsement. This means if ⁢you hold an active,valid CNA license in another state,you can apply for a⁤ Florida CNA license without starting from⁣ scratch. However,specific criteria must be met,and there ⁤are clear steps to follow. Recognizing and understanding these procedures is crucial to make your licensure ⁤transfer seamless.

Step-by-Step Process to Transfer Your CNA License to Florida

step 1: Verify Your Current​ CNA License ⁢Status

Begin by verifying that your⁣ CNA license is active,in​ good standing,and eligible‌ for ⁣license transfer.Visit your current state’s nursing board website to get a license verification letter or⁤ certificate. Ensure no restrictions or disciplinary actions are pending, as ​these can affect your eligibility.

Step 2: Gather Necessary ⁢Documentation

Collect essential documents required for the Florida CNA license transfer request:

  • Proof ⁣of your ⁣current CNA license (license number⁣ and issue date)
  • Verification of license status from your current state
  • Identification credentials (driver’s license, social Security ⁣number)
  • Social⁣ security card
  • Completed Florida Nurse Aide Registry application
  • Proof of completed​ CNA training (if needed)
  • Background check authorization
  • Passport-sized photo⁣ (if applicable)

Step 3: ‌Submit the Florida CNA License Transfer Application

You can apply online via the Florida Department of Health’s Nursing Registry portal or submit a paper application.⁢ Ensure all forms are ‌completed accurately and all necessary ‍documentation is attached.​ Pay the applicable ⁢fee, usually around $150, to process your⁢ application.

Step 4: Complete the Florida CNA Competency Exam (if required)

In most cases, if your ⁤current CNA license is from a state recognized by Florida, you may not​ need to retake the competency exam. ‌Though, if your license cannot be reciprocally recognized,‍ you will be required to pass the Florida CNA ‍competency exam, wich includes a written and skills test. Schedule‌ your exam through a​ Florida-approved‍ testing provider.

Step 5: Wait‌ for Application Processing and​ review

Processing times ‍can ⁢vary⁢ but typically take from 2 to 4​ weeks. During this period, the Florida Department of Health reviews ⁤your application, verifies your credentials, and confirms your eligibility.Be prepared to respond quickly if additional ‍data or clarification is requested.

Step 6: Receive Your Florida CNA License

Once approved, you will ⁣receive your Florida CNA ⁤license either by mail or⁤ electronically, ⁤depending on your application method. Confirm all details are ‌correct and begin your CNA practice in‌ Florida confidently.
